9 months agoWe had a few hours between disembarking and our flight home so we spent an hour out on the water paddleboarding! It was gorgeous, easy, and fun. We were dealing with some travel woes due to the tech outage and the man (I'm sorry I forgot his name) with Miami Beach Paddleboard was patient and helpful. The floating dock and the area where you board could not be more stunning! We even got off in the cove and swam for a bit! We highly recommend this business!

a year agoAlthough we couldn’t use the groupon to be issues on the day, we were offered to cancel it and use same price for on the day experience. You get to paddle in fairly quiet area (in April) next to multimillion dollar mansions and boats. We definitely recommend to do 2 hours and it felt like just enough to explore the circle. Lovely experience but keep in mind you have to walk with paddle boards from the shop to the shore which is roughly 2-3 minutes. We were fine with that but people with less strength or mobility might struggle. Definitely would come back

2 years agoI had called to book a 2 hour lesson. I booked it & showed up. The staff was super friendly & welcoming. After I signed the waver I was told I would have a quick explanation about paddle boarding before they send me off. I was a tad confused as I had assumed the 2 hours was a lesson. They noticed I was extremely nervous & really took the time to explain in a quick 5 minute tutorial. Which is all that is needed to get started. There is a super easy kayak/ paddleboard launch area with a bar to hold onto. Once I got into the water it was absolutely amazing & so glad I trusted the guys that it was easy. ( it took a few tries before I was able to stand. ) Once I was finish one of the guys was there & helped me out.
